#db0910 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#db0910 is composed of 85.9% red, 3.5%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 95.9% magenta, 92.7% yellow and 14.1% black. It has a hue angle of 358 degrees, a saturation of 92.1% and a lightness of 44.7%. #db0910 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ff1220 with #b70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

Shades and Tints of #db0910
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0001 is the darkest color, while #fff8f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#db0910
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7b696a is the less saturated color, while #e40008 is the most saturated one.
